Kuemper Catholic guard Parker Badding
What colleges have been recruiting you?
“Mainly it has just been Briar Cliff that has been interested.”

Have you made any college trips yet?
“I’ll be taking a trip to Briar Cliff once the season opens up more. Hopefully I can get more colleges interested in me at that time.”

Pella athlete Donovan Holterhaus
Do you have a sporting preference?
“I really like football after the football and had a lot of fun. I have always liked basketball so I don't know yet. I like them both.”

Has there been any interest for football?
“I haven't gotten anything yet. My coach said that NSDU has contacted him along with a couple of others. I haven't had any personal contact.”

What has been the interest been for basketball?
“Central College here in town and Northwestern in Orange City. That is pretty much it.”

Have you made any college trips yet?
“I visited them both. I also talked to Coach Jacobson at UNI and I was thinking about trying to walk on there.”

Did you have a favorite college growing up?
“I have always liked UNI and always wanted to go there since I was little. My dad played basketball there and I have always wanted to go there.”

Dubuque Hempstead guard Lucas Duax
What colleges have been recruiting you?
“Upper Iowa has been interest and Platteville has been too. Those are the main ones.”

Have you made any college trips yet?
“I went to both colleges over the fall. They had great campuses. I met all the coaches and came away impressed. I went to a game of each and they were both fun.”

What school is recruiting you the hardest?
“With Robert (Duax) at Platteville, I go to most of their games and usually talk to their coaches more. Maybe it is Platteville but there is not a huge difference.”

West Branch guard Beau Cornwell
What colleges have been recruiting you?
“It has just been stuff from Division III, II, and NAIA schools. They have been inviting me to camps but I haven't been able to attend because I broke my collarbone during football.”

What are some of the main schools?
“For Division III, it is Central College and Cornell. They have been asking me a lot of questions and talking to me. There are a lot of Division II schools. I just can’t name any of them specifically.”

Have you made any college trips yet?
“Not yet.”

Gehlen Catholic lineman Bryan Nohava
What colleges have been recruiting you?
“I talked to Morningside a little bit and Dordt. It is a little early but those are the ones I’ve talked to so far.”

Have you made any college trips yet?
“Not really.”

Did you have a favorite college growing up?
“Iowa. That is where the best offensive linemen go. I would love to go there or NDSU.”

Cedar Rapids Xavier guard Matt Mims
What colleges have been recruiting you?
“I have been in contact with Illinois State, UNI, Drake, North Dakota, South Dakota, Davidson contacted me coach, Nebraska has been sending a lot of stuff, Dartmouth, Southern Mississippi, and Cornell University in New York. Those are the main ones.”

Have you made any college trips yet?
“I took a visit this fall to North Dakota with Owen Coburn and that was pretty fun. I want to make it to a game at South Dakota. I’ve been talking to one of their coaches about that at some time during the season.”

How was your time at North Dakota?
“I liked it a lot. It was a lot different than I thought it’d be. The coaches are really nice. I watched their second practice and they were getting after it. It was nice to see the competition.”

What school is recruiting you the hardest?
“I’d probably say North Dakota. I talk to Coach Horner quite a bit.”

West Branch lineman Jacob Barnhart
What colleges have been recruiting you?
“I talked to Coach Reese Morgan from Iowa and had a conversation with him. I bumped into the Northwest Missouri State coach when he was in talking to Butch. I haven't gotten any letters yet.”

When did you get a chance to speak with Coach Morgan?
“It was probably last spring late in the school year. He was talking to Butch and I bumped into him.”

Did you have a favorite college growing up?
“I never really started watching football until eighth grade but Iowa has always been a favorite of mine.”

Oskaloosa kicker Aaron Blom
Do you have a favorite sport?
“Football would probably be my favorite sport.”

What colleges have been recruiting you?
“I have had a little bit of interest from Iowa State with camp invites and Wisconsin. That has been about it.”

What camps are you planning to get to this summer?
“I am planning on attending Iowa, Iowa State, probably Wisconsin, and I hope Michigan and/or Ohio State. I also want to get to the National Scholarship Camp for Kohls.”

Did you have a favorite college growing up?
“I’ve always been keeping an eye on Alabama and Iowa State. Those two are my favorites.”
